Output 758cbc1550359638d14ffc7366ee733ebd065ad7e2c63f14c369e5bf442eba5f:1

value
24567000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f2f88c33e4c5d6e62736d908890cf2abd9f425d OP_EQUAL
address
MRL4EohSfHKgU4eSEh5SFkMZCP1BcKAKhz
transaction
758cbc1550359638d14ffc7366ee733ebd065ad7e2c63f14c369e5bf442eba5f
spent
true